Step 2: Ask for Reviews Immediately
Do a few free or discounted jobs for people you trust, and ask them to write honest reviews. Then display those reviews proudly on your website and social profiles.
Step 3: Respond Quickly
Your speed builds confidence. Reply to leads, show up on time, and keep things clear and professional.
Clients want someone they can trust more than someone who’s perfect. Present yourself well, and you’ll win before you even pick up a tool.
